Scrub Oak, Bear Oak Quercus ilicifolia
Price : CALL

* Quercus ilicifolia, commonly known as Bear Oak or Scrub Oak, is a small shrubby oak native to the northeastern United States and southeastern Canada. * This oak has been used in revegetation projects on the Fresh Kills Landfill on Staten Island.

Scrub Oak Quercus berberidifolia     - Quercus dumosa  f. berberidifolia
Price : CALL

* In cooler, more exposed areas, scrub oak is usually a small, compact shrub, but in warm or sheltered areas the plant can spread out and grow several meters high. * The word chaparral is derived from the Spanish word for scrub oak, chaparro.

Himalayan Spruce, Morinda Spruce Picea smithiana
Price : CALL

* Likes abundant moisture at the roots, if grown in drier areas it must be given a deep moist soil. It grows at altitudes of 2,400-3,600 m in forests together with Deodar Cedar, Blue Pine and Pindrow Fir.
